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- Most of the time, metal polishing is necessary for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room uses. It's one of the most preferred processes simply because of its use in boosting the original beauty of the item, for example, motor bike parts, cookware or vehicle parts. Aside from that, a great many clean-rooms really need a burnished finish in order to minimize the perviousness of the material which may cause dirt to collect and contaminate. A superb illustration of this practice could be in vacuum chambers. You will discover a large number of means to finish metals, and now we are going to go over a bit in relation to a number of the procedures involved. Metals may be burnished manually by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A finishing paste or compound is often put into use, which could contain ch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its rather high viscidity is considered the most time intensive. Opposite of that scenario, goods fabricated from non-ferrous metal are more amenable to finishing, mainly because these call for the lower number of procedures.
Any time a greater processing quality is not really demanded, faster pad speeds can be utilized. A decreased pad speed is required when a top qu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s daubed with paste can be significantly affected by the force on the finish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ure may be elevated within certain ranges, but going above the optimum level of pressure not simply lowers the quality of treatment, but also degrades performance, could result in wear to the product, and there is also an evident heating of the pieces being worked on, brought about by friction. When you are working on thinner material, it's elevated heat (and the ensuing pliancy of the material) that causes elements to flex, buckle or twist. In general, it needs a seasoned technician to look at all these things to equally avert damage to the workpiece and to operate successfully. In order to substantially enhance the quality of the resultant finish, the buffing operation really needs to be performed with reduced aggression and not as much force so that you can finally de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scratches or marks as a consequence of the buffing procedure, thus arriving at a fabulous mirror finish.
